技术问答类推广文案:GBase 数据库常见问题与解决方案
在当今数据驱动的商业环境中,数据库作为企业信息系统的核心组件,承担着数据存储、管理与分析的关键任务。GBase 作为一款高性能、高可用的商业数据库产品,广泛应用于金融、电信、政府、制造等多个行业。为了帮助用户更好地理解和使用 GBase 数据库,本文将围绕“GBase-数据-Database-商业数据库未来常见问题解决”这一主题,整理并解答一些常见的技术问题。
一、什么是 GBase 数据库?
GBase 是由南大通用(GBase)研发的一系列关系型数据库管理系统,包括 GBase 8a、GBase 8s 等多个版本,适用于不同的应用场景。它具备高并发处理能力、良好的扩展性以及丰富的功能模块,是企业构建数据平台的理想选择。
特点: - 支持标准 SQL 查询 - 提供高可用架构(如主备、集群) - 支持大数据量存储与高效查询 - 适配多种操作系统和硬件平台
二、GBase 数据库常见问题及解决方案
1. 如何优化 GBase 数据库的查询性能?
问题描述:
用户在使用 GBase 数据库时发现某些查询响应时间较长,影响系统效率。
解决方案:
- 索引优化: 对频繁查询的字段建立合适的索引,避免全表扫描。
- SQL 语句优化: 避免使用 SELECT *
,减少不必要的字段返回;合理使用 JOIN
和子查询。
- 分区表: 对于大表可考虑使用分区策略,提升查询效率。
- 定期维护: 执行 ANALYZE TABLE
更新统计信息,帮助优化器生成更优的执行计划。
2. GBase 数据库如何实现高可用?
问题描述:
企业对数据库的稳定性要求较高,希望了解 GBase 如何保障服务不中断。
解决方案: - 主从复制: 通过主库与从库之间的数据同步,实现读写分离和故障切换。 - 集群部署: 使用 GBase 集群版本(如 GBase 8a 集群),支持多节点负载均衡与自动故障转移。 - 日志备份与恢复: 定期进行增量备份与全量备份,确保数据安全。
3. GBase 数据库如何处理大数据量?
问题描述:
随着业务增长,数据量急剧增加,用户担心 GBase 是否能应对海量数据。
解决方案: - 分布式架构: GBase 支持分布式部署,可通过分片(Sharding)技术实现横向扩展。 - 列式存储: GBase 8a 采用列式存储方式,适合大规模数据分析场景。 - 内存优化: 合理配置内存参数,提升数据缓存效率。
4. GBase 数据库兼容性如何?
问题描述:
企业在迁移数据库过程中,关心 GBase 是否支持现有应用系统。
解决方案: - SQL 兼容性: GBase 支持标准 SQL 语法,兼容 Oracle、MySQL 等主流数据库。 - 接口支持: 提供 JDBC、ODBC、ADO.NET 等多种接口,方便与各类应用系统集成。 - 迁移工具: 提供数据库迁移工具,支持从其他数据库平滑迁移到 GBase。
三、GBase 数据库的未来发展
随着云计算、大数据和人工智能技术的发展,数据库系统正朝着智能化、云原生、分布式方向演进。GBase 也在持续升级其产品线,以满足未来企业的需求:
- 云原生支持: 推出基于容器化和 Kubernetes 的部署方案,适应云上环境。
- AI 驱动优化: 引入智能调优机制,自动识别慢查询并给出优化建议。
- 混合云架构: 支持本地与云端数据协同,构建灵活的数据管理平台。
四、结语
GBase 数据库凭借其高性能、高可用性和良好的扩展性,已经成为众多企业数据管理的重要选择。面对日益复杂的数据挑战,掌握 GBase 的常见问题与解决方案,不仅能提高系统运行效率,还能为企业数字化转型提供坚实支撑。
如您在使用 GBase 数据库过程中遇到任何问题,欢迎咨询官方技术支持团队,我们将为您提供专业、高效的解决方案。
GBase——让数据更有价值,让未来更可期。